For my hike this hot August morning, I explored one end of the blue-blazed Cross-Fells Trail, which crosses my usual Skyline Trail. I came upon a family memorial, a rock in a tree, some lovely marshes, and a surprise: the very end of the trail was submerged and impassible. |
